#6E6383 Hex Color Code

#6E6383

The Hexadecimal Color #6E6383 is a contrast shade of Dim Gray. #6E6383 RGB value is rgb(110, 99, 131). RGB Color Model of #6E6383 consists of 43% red, 38% green and 51% blue. HSL color Mode of #6E6383 has 261°(degrees) Hue, 14% Saturation and 45% Lightness. #6E6383 color has an wavelength of 455.66667n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#6E6383 is #996699.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#6E6383 is #668. The Closest Color to #6E6383 is #696969. Official Name of #6E6383 Hex Code is Rum.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#6E6383 is 16 Cyan 24 Magenta 0 Yellow 49 Black and #6E6383 CMY is 16, 24,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#6E6383 is hsl(261,14,45,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(261, 24, 51).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#6E6383 is 14.99, 13.88, 23.36.
Hex8 Value of #6E6383 is #6E6383FF. Decimal Value of #6E6383 is 7234435 and Octal Value of #6E6383 is 33461603. Binary Value of #6E6383 is 1101110, 1100011, 10000011 and Android of #6E6383 is 4285424515 / 0xff6e6383.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#6E6383 is 0.287, 0.266, 0.266 and YIQ Color Space of #6E6383 is 105.937, -3.7267, 12.2849.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#6E6383 is 13.15, 13.16, 23.21.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#6E6383 is 44.06, 11.26, -16.18.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#6E6383 is 44.06, 3.79, -24.28.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#6E6383 is 44.06, 19.71, 304.83. Hunter Lab variable of #6E6383 is 37.26, 6.62, -11.1.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#6E6383

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
